The 18-hole Brooker Creek Golf Club in Palm Harbor, FL is a semi-private golf course that opened in 1971. Designed by Lane Marshall, Brooker Creek Golf Club measures 6504 yards from the longest tees and has a slope rating of 129 and a 71.3 USGA rating. The course features 3 sets of tees for different skill levels.

Length, slope and rating for each tee

Tee Par Yardage Slope Rating
Back 72 6504 129 71.3
Forward (W) 72 5252 123 70.6
Middle 72 6022 124 69.5
